Material Handler I is responsible for safely moving materials and products throughout the manufacturing facility, supporting production flow, and maintaining organized inventory. This role plays a key part in ensuring materials are available where and when needed to keep operations running efficiently.

Essential Functions:

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• Operate a forklift to safely move materials between departments, yard, and production areas
  • Load and unload incoming and outgoing materials and finished goods
  • Stock and organize materials in designated inventory locations
  • Supply production areas with materials to maintain workflow and efficiency
  • Perform basic visual inspections of incoming materials for quality and accuracy
  • Conduct counts and verify inventory against documentation
  • Identify and report equipment issues, material discrepancies, or safety concerns
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ment
  • Follow all safety procedures and properly use required personal protective equipment (PPE)
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support production and warehouse operations
